OSTER TOASTER OVEN PARTS

Oster toaster ovens, like all toaster ovens, consist of a body, an analog or digital control panel, and accessories that contribute to the proper operation of the appliance.

Body: The exterior construction of Oster toaster ovens is generally stainless steel or sometimes aluminum with heating vents. These materials are more or less prone to heating, so care must be taken when turning on the appliances.

Door: the door is another important element of a toaster oven. Depending on the Oster models, the door can be single or double.

In addition, the two types of doors have a durable glass center body, which allows you to see inside the cooking status of the food.

Oster toaster ovens with single doors are usually the most compact and economical and offer more limited visibility than models with double doors.

In contrast, units with double doors, also called French doors, are large and are at the high end of the entire range.

In this case, visibility is greater and they facilitate the insertion of longer pans.

Control panel: the control panel of Oster toaster ovens can be analog or digital depending on the model.

In the case of an appliance with digital controls, there are one-touch buttons and a display that indicates the operation performed by pressing the buttons.

Models with analog controls, on the other hand, consist of knobs that can be turned to select the chosen setting.

The choice of the best type of control is subjective and depends on whether one wants a technologically advanced model or a more “old-fashioned” and simple device.

Accessories: the basic accessory included with Oster toaster ovens is a rectangular stainless steel baking pan.

In addition, you can find more than one grill, a pizza or cake pan, and a crumb tray that helps prevent dirt inside the toaster oven.

HOW TO PREHEAT AN OSTER TOASTER OVEN?

Preheating a toaster oven is recommended depending on the recipes you want to cook. The procedure for preheating an Oster unit is simple and consists of three steps:

A) Close the oven door and make sure it is securely closed.

B) Set the desired cooking temperature.

C) Wait about 10–15 minutes for the oven to preheat properly. The preheating time is variable and depends from model to model.

Some Oster toaster ovens are faster than others at this stage, so read the instruction manual carefully to know exactly how long it takes.

HOW TO CLEAN THE OSTER TOASTER OVEN?

Cleaning an Oster toaster is important to prevent food buildup inside, and the life of the appliance itself. Here are three steps you can take to effectively clean the appliance:

1)Unplug it: the first thing to do is to unplug the appliance from the power outlet and wait for it to cool down.

2) Pull out all components: proceed by removing all accessories from the toaster, such as the pans, grids, and crumb tray.

The latter facilitates cleaning, as its function is to retain crumbs and grease inside.

3)Clean the appliance and all components: take a damp sponge and thoroughly clean the inside of the appliance and all accessories.

In some models, you can speed up this process by putting the components in the dishwasher. (Read the instructions for use carefully).

Is the Oster convection oven the same as an air fryer?

No. The operation of an Oster convection oven and a generic air fryer is not the same, although both take advantage of convection cooking to cook food.

In an Oster convection oven, the heating elements are located at the top and bottom, while in an air fryer the heating element is located only at the top.

In addition, an air fryer has a basket for frying food, while in the case of an Oster convection oven there are pans that fit into special shelves.

Can you put aluminum foil in the Oster toaster oven?

Oster does not recommend putting aluminum foil in its toasters oven, as the units risk heating above 500 degrees, cracking, and causing fires.
